Shiner Day Quencher Session Ale Review
Shiner Day Quencher is more ballpark brew than trend-setter. Somewhat conflicting with its "tropical" promises, this session ale pours clear and golden with a rocky white head, and bready, biscuity aromas jump from the glass. The body is light and crisp, with subtle grain flavor and a bitter finish. Although this beer boasts being dry-hopped with Mosaic, both hop aroma and flavor are extremely subtle, save for a slight bitterness.
